Autorenporträt
Carlo Collodi (1826-1890) was the pen name of Carlo Lorenzini. The Florence native took the name of his mother's native village, where he attended school. Collodi served in the Tuscan army during the Italian wars of independence and founded a satirical weekly, Il Lampione. The author of novels, plays, and political sketches, he translated Charles Perrault's fairy tales from the French, and in 1881 his Storia di un burratino (Story of a Puppet) was published in installments in the Giornale per i bambini, appearing two years later in book form as The Adventures of Pinocchio.
